After the fight, whether you decide to kill Ethel or not, a conversation with Mayrina will trigger.
You’ll need this to resurrect Connor and continue Mayrina’s quest.
If you do not grab the wand Bitter Divorce, the quest cannot progress any further.
Once you’ve grabbed the wand, you canexit Ethel’s lairby interacting with the mushroom circle.
This will teleport you outside, and Mayrina will be just a few steps away at Connor’s coffin.
With Bitter Divorce in your inventory, you’ll have the option totell Mayrina you could resurrect her husband.
You should pick the dialogue option topoint the wand at the coffin.
From here, you’ll need to decide what to do with Mayrina’s zombified husband.

Keep The Wand For Yourself
If you choose this option, you will gain the itemSecond Marriage.
This wand allows you tocast a spell tosummon Connor at the cost of an action.
*Connor’s Undead Fortitude does not trigger if he was killed by Radiant damage.
As a result, we highly recommend keeping Connor away from enemies or traps that might deal Radiant damage.
